CPU Thermal Trip Status (CTS) — R/WC. This bit is set when PCIRST# is inactive and
CPUTHRMTRIP# goes active while the system is in an S0 or S1 state. This bit is also reset by
RSMRST# and CF9h resets. It is not reset by the shutdown and reboot associated with the
CPUTHRMTRIP# event.
